mongodb czym sa pliki i bazy danych ?

mongodb czym sa pliki i bazy danych ?
Logilink
  • Rejestracja: dni
  • Ostatnio: dni
  • Postów: 5
0

Witam,czy ktoś z was może mi wytłumaczyć czym s bazy danych i pliki w MongoDB ?
Najlepiej na podstawie różnicy z PostgreSQL ..

Dzięki z góry .

Naprawdę nikt nie jest w stanie pomóc ?

@Shalom - nie potrafisz czytać po Polsku ? Może inaczej, w jaki sposób mondodb przechowuje informacje ?

n0name_l
  • Rejestracja: dni
  • Ostatnio: dni
  • Postów: 2412
0

Ban na google?

Zamiast tego, dane składowane są jako dokumenty w stylu JSON

Shalom
  • Rejestracja: dni
  • Ostatnio: dni
  • Lokalizacja: Space: the final frontier
  • Postów: 26433
Logilink
  • Rejestracja: dni
  • Ostatnio: dni
  • Postów: 5
0

Teraz łaskawie wytłumaczcie jak to jest składowane, row jest plikiem ? baza danych jest katalogiem ? Jak to jest rozwiązane ?

Shalom
  • Rejestracja: dni
  • Ostatnio: dni
  • Lokalizacja: Space: the final frontier
  • Postów: 26433
0

Ewidentnie marnujesz czas. Informatyka to nie jest coś dla ciebie z takim podejściem.
http://docs.mongodb.org/manual/faq/storage/

Logilink
  • Rejestracja: dni
  • Ostatnio: dni
  • Postów: 5
0

Ewidentnie nie rozumiesz idei forum, gdyby Twoja logika była trochę bardziej elastyczna, nie napisałbyś takiej strasznej głupoty.
Rżniesz strasznego cwaniaka, pytanie tylko po co ? nie zaimponujesz nikomu. Masz jakieś emocjonalne problemy ? Tak trudno odpowiedzieć ci rzeczowo na pytani użytkownika forum ? :)

Te same odnośniki wypluwa google, napisz coś od siebie w tym temacie ..

Shalom
  • Rejestracja: dni
  • Ostatnio: dni
  • Lokalizacja: Space: the final frontier
  • Postów: 26433
1

Nie. To ty nie rozumiesz najwyraźniej na czym polega praca w IT. 75% czasu polega to właśnie na szukaniu informacji. Ty tej umiejętności nie posiadasz, co więcej przychodzisz z roszczeniową postawą "Napiszcie mi XYZ, byle szybko bo pan i władca czeka". Ja tego nie mówię ze złośliwości :) Wręcz przeciwnie - chcę ci pomóc żebyś nie zmarnował niepotrzebnie czasu na uczenie sie czegoś co ci sie nie przyda. Informatyka jest właśnie czymś takim. To nie jest dziedzina dla ciebie, przykro mi.

Logilink
  • Rejestracja: dni
  • Ostatnio: dni
  • Postów: 5
1

Szanowny Panie, jakiej postawy spodziewasz się po przeczytaniu twojej pierwszej lepszej odpowiedzi, nie tylko w tym wątku jak już zdążyłem zobaczyć.
Rozumie, że wyznaczasz standardy pracy w ogólnym sektorze IT i jesteś w tym zakresie specjalistą, cóż chylę czoła ..

Jeśli naprawdę chcesz mi pomóc wyciągnij paluszki na klawiaturę i napisz 2,3 pełne zdania od siebie, nawiązując do moich pytań.
Błędnie odebrałeś moją postawę, nie oczekuje absolutnie niczego, jeśli ktoś zechce odpisać rzeczowo i na temat, będę zobowiązany ..

_13th_Dragon
  • Rejestracja: dni
  • Ostatnio: dni
0

@Logilink, popieram to co powiedział @Shalom, lepiej zrezygnuj z tej dziedziny, jeżeli nie jesteś w stanie:

  1. Wyciągnąć informacji z podanego linku FAQ o zbliżonym tytule co twoje pytanie
  2. Kulturalnie rozmawiać z ludźmi
  3. Zrozumieć że forum to nie dział referentów w twojej firmie
    to na żadnej pracy w sektorze IT nie pociągniesz długo.
somekind
  • Rejestracja: dni
  • Ostatnio: dni
  • Lokalizacja: Wrocław
1

Panowie, nie przesadzacie trochę? Autor czegoś nie rozumie, więc o to spytał, bardzo grzecznie i kulturalnie. Wewnętrzne działanie jakiejś technologii to zazwyczaj nie są takie oczywiste sprawy. Jeśli naprawdę nie jesteście w stanie nic wyjaśnić poza odesłaniem do Google, to lepiej nic nie piszcie.

Logilink
  • Rejestracja: dni
  • Ostatnio: dni
  • Postów: 5
0

@somekind dziękuje za wyrozumiałość, Panowie swoim pytaniem absolutnie nie chciałem nikogo złościć, w dalszym ciągu nie bardzo rozumie jak to fizycznie wygląda, tj. jak składowane są informacje przez bazę danych.
Będę zobowiązany za wszelkie informacje.

n0name_l
  • Rejestracja: dni
  • Ostatnio: dni
  • Postów: 2412
0

Moze sprecyzuj o co Ci konkretnie chodzi z tym trzymaniem przez baze danych?

Kazda baza ma swoj plik *.ns, ktory zawiera metadane i wiele plikow przechowujacych same dane.
Pliki z danymi sa nazywane odpowiednio, dla bazy o nazwie foo: foo.0, foo.1, foo.2, ....
Pliki te sa zorganizowane w przestrzenie nazw, a dane z kazdej przestrzeni sa przechowywane w tzw. extents. Kazda przestrzen nazw moze miec ich dowolna ilosc i same extents nie musza byc "ciagle" na dysku.

Zarejestruj się i dołącz do największej społeczności programistów w Polsce.

Otrzymaj wsparcie, dziel się wiedzą i rozwijaj swoje umiejętności z najlepszymi.